THE MOST IMPORTANT INVENTION:
TELEVISION
1. Since its invention, television has become the most important telecommunication instrument in the world. There are very few communities in the world that do not have a TV in every household.
2. On the positive side, it has made a great contribution to mankind since its invention. For example, documentary programs, such as 揇iscovery?enrich our lives.
3. On the negative side, it has resulted in people not having time to spend with one another. For example, parents and children do not spend so much time talking to each other as in the past.
As for the applications of TV are concerned, I would like to explain by mentioning the following:
4. Firstly, TV is used widely in long distance education. For example, the TV University in China is the largest university in the world. It has millions of students throughout the country, following many diverse programs.
5. In addition, TV is a great source of entertainment. What I mean to say is that we can watch movies, soap operas, TV series, and live performances by artists in the comfort of our own homes.
